  • 13-14 October 2010 VI-grade will host its 3rd International Users Conference
    Following the very affirmative feedback received by more than 100 attendees of each of the first two conferences held in Marburg and Udine in 2007 and 2008 ("Fantastic location, seamless organization, lots of interesting presentations." said one of the participants of the last VI-grade Users Conference) VI-grade decided to host the international event in the Dolce Hotel & Resort located in charming Bad Nauheim, just 35 kilometers north of Frankfurt am Main and close to the VI-grade Headquarters’ office in Marburg.

    The event, characterized by the motto “Visualize Future Challenges Today”, is dedicated to all upcoming development challenges and opportunities today's engineers and developers face. The conference will give attendees a forum to talk, exchange, network and learn and will provide a unique opportunity for simulation engineers from various industries to get exposed to the latest technology in advanced system simulation, to get ready for future development challenges, and to handle today's engineering tasks. 

    “The bandwidth of upcoming development challenges is huge” said Juergen Fett, Managing Director of VI-grade GmbH. “We are looking forward to welcoming to our Bad Nauheim event a growing number of presentations that prove how our customers use our products to manage multidisciplinary development tasks of new drive concepts, to handle future mobility concepts and to address increased safety and reduced energy consumption requirements.”

    A special highlight of this year's conference, which will attract users from the Automotive, Motorsports, Motorcycle, Aerospace, Rail, Real Time, Controls, Driver-In-the-Loop, Engine or New Drive Concept industries, will be the new driving simulator the VI-grade team has developed and built with partners.
